SterlingBackcheck Architect Salary

The average SterlingBackcheck Architect earns an estimated $149,703 annually. SterlingBackcheck's Architect compensation is $2,834 more than the US average for a Architect.

The Engineering Department at SterlingBackcheck earns $2,720 more on average than the Design Department.

Architect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female Architect at companies similar size to SterlingBackcheck reported making $152,852, while the average male Architect at similar sized companies reported making $155,612.

Architect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average Caucasian Architect at companies similar size to SterlingBackcheck reported making $155,133, while the average Native American Architect at similar sized companies reported making $101,895.
